Warm Hug Reads

1. Legends & Lattes by Travis Baldree

2. A Psalm for the Wild-Built by Becky Chambers

3. In the Company of Witches by Auralee Wallace

4. Under the Whispering Door by TJ Klune

5. Emily Wilde’s Encyclopedia of Faeries by Heather Fawcett

6. Long Live the Pumpkin Queen by Shea Ernshaw

7. Forged by Magic by Jenna Wolfhart

8. The Saturday Night Ghost Club by Craig Davidson

9. The Dead Romantics by Ashley Poston

10. The Undertaking of Hart and Mercy by Megan Bannen

11. Angelika Frankenstein Makes Her Match by Sally Throne

12. The Halloween Tree by Ray Bradbury

13. So This is Ever After by F.T. Lukens


Spooky/Horror

1. The Only Good Indians by Stephen Graham Jones

2. The Watchers by A.M Shine

3. Our Share of Night by Mariana Enriquez

4. The Thicket by Noelle W. Ihli

5. Uzumaki by Junji Ito

6. The Hacienda by Isabel Cañas

7. The October Country: Stories by Ray Bradbury

8. The Laws of the Skies by Grégoire Courtois

9. The Cask of Amontillado by Edgar Allan Poe

10. Something Wicked This Way Comes by Ray Bradbury

11. Coraline by Neil Gaiman

12. Slewfoot: A Tale of Bewitchery by Brom

13. Mothering by Ainslie Hogarth
